Sidley Adds Patel as Partner in Restructuring Group

byIan Koplin
April 5, 2023
in People

Sidley added partner Rakhee V. Patel to its restructuring group. Patel joins Texas-based partners Duston McFaul and Charles Persons in Sidley’s growing global restructuring practice. Patel is a key component of Sidley’s focus on the growth of its company-side restructuring representations worldwide. Prior to joining Sidley, Patel was a partner with a national firm in their corporate restructuring and bankruptcy practice group and has more than 26-years of experience in the field.

Patel is a practitioner in corporate reorganization and has extensive experience advising clients on in- and out-of-court restructurings, distressed investments and related litigation. Her experience spans a wide variety of markets and industries, including energy, hospitality, financial products, retail, distribution, manufacturing, aviation, financial services, life sciences and real estate. A Chambers USA-ranked partner, Patel recently was selected as a fellow in the American College of Bankruptcy and inducted in Washington, D.C.

“Rakhee not only has the skills and drive to support our growing restructuring practice through her deep experience and profile in Texas, but she is also strategic and thoughtful when working with clients and colleagues. Her tenacity and team-oriented values will serve her well as she grows her client base at Sidley,” Yvette Ostolaza, management committee chair and executive committee member at Sidley, said. “Her reputation with bankruptcy judges is in the highest regard and her knowledge from debtor representations to creditors or lenders and ad hoc committees will bolster our reach as we continue to grow our restructuring practice.”

“Rakhee bolsters our team with her extensive experience and deep connections,” Stephen Hessler, restructuring group global practice lead at Sidley, said. “For years our lawyers have worked across from Rakhee and have been impressed with her skills and results. She will be a valuable asset to our global restructuring clients and practice.”
